2008-11-21 4 views
2

У меня есть это веб-приложение .NET, которое рисует таблицу в Page_Load..NET (web) Как выполнить некоторый код после обработки всех событий?

Затем после этого обрабатываются события, которые должны изменить таблицу, нарисованную в Page_Load. Это очень неэффективно.

Есть ли способ выполнить код (который рисует таблицу) после завершения обработки всех событий? (вместо того, чтобы делать это в Page_Load)

Спасибо заранее.

ответ

5

Вам нужно обработать событие, которое происходит после событий контроля, но до того, как страница отображается, например, LoadComplete или PreRender.

За дополнительной информацией обращайтесь к ASP.NET Page Life Cycle Overview.

0

Проверьте событие OnPreRender в жизненном цикле страницы.

-Oisin

0

Вы также можете поместить код в событие тикового таймера с интервалом в 1, который будет срабатывать после всех событий.

Смежные вопросы